Burglary suspected at business with possible rooftop intruder, Los Angeles CA


A possible burglary is reported at a business on Vineland Avenue. There are reports of a suspect possibly on the roof. Police units are setting up a perimeter and making contact with the reporting party inside the business.

Police codes explained
The following codes appeared in the transcript and are explained below:
[1]
459: Burglary or burglary alarm, including attempted, residential, vehicle, or in-progress incidents.
[2]
PR: Person or party reporting an incident to law enforcement (caller, complainant, victim, or witness).
[3]
Code 2: Urgent, non-emergency response; proceed promptly without lights or siren, obeying all traffic laws.
